Years 9 & 10

Pupils will receive career education through career lessons delivered as part of their PSHE lessons.  Lessons will focus on identifying strengths and weaknesses and skills. Pupils in Year 9 will concentrate on choosing GCSE subjects that will help them progress in the future.

Year 11

Pupils in Year 11 will complete the psychometric tests on Unifrog. During PSHE lessons they will have the opportunity to research the options these have highlighted and will discuss the outcomes with their tutor and Head of Guidance.

Supporting International University Applications

At Mount Kelly, we understand that many pupils aspire to continue their education beyond the UK, whether at prestigious universities in their home countries or abroad. Our dedicated Guidance team provides tailored support for international university applications, helping pupils navigate the complex admissions processes with confidence.

For pupils interested in studying in their home countries, we offer personalised advice on application requirements, entrance exams, and interview preparation to maximise their chances of success.

We also recognise the growing interest in pursuing higher education in the USA, particularly through NCAA College Sports scholarships. Mount Kelly’s strong sporting tradition, especially in swimming and girls’ football, makes us a natural gateway for pupils aiming to combine academic excellence with elite-level sport. Our experienced team guides aspiring student-athletes through the NCAA recruitment process, including eligibility certification, application support, and communication with US college coaches. Lectures on USA pathways are available to all pupils from Year 9 upwards throughout the year. We also regularly welcome representatives from US colleges to our campus to meet with potential applicants.
